  • 摘要:Automatic weather station, one of the most significant observation instruments in China, has several particular characteristics, including precise parts, complex structure and various failures. Traditional training mode always relies on physical instruments which need large amounts of investment with long update cycle. During process of training, it is subject to making damage to instruments and trainees, which leads to ineffective even terminated training. Therefore, one new training mode is badly in need. Based on Web3D technology, this paper proposes one feasible virtual training application which takes into account particular characteristics of training for automatic weather station. It also describes an overall training plan, technology architecture, major module design and detailed implementation. This application has filled the blank of virtual Web3D training for automatic weather station, and opened up one new training approach. Also, the application scope of Web3D technology has been extended, especially into virtual training of specialized instruments.
